Job Requirements/Qualifications
- Must have at a minimum of 15+ years of experience in the Healthcare field focused on engineering and facilities design and/or actively managed the operation and construction of healthcare facilities.
- Must have managed the design and execution of construction projects valued at $5M or more.
- Must have a strong knowledge and application of NFPA 99, 101 and the most recent version of the Facilities Guideline Institute (FGI) to include ASHRAE 170, Ventilation for Healthcare Facilities.
- Must have strong knowledge and understanding of Joint Commission standards and the Centers for Medicaid & Medicare (CMS) for healthcare as it relates to accreditation standards for healthcare owners.
- Must have strong leadership capabilities in leading a team of highly trained personnel to create a comprehensive, integrated work team to execute excellence in healthcare design, diagnostics, and implementation of strategized solutions.
- On a continuous basis, must keep abreast of new technologies, evidence-based design, code developments, energy efficiency strategies, etc…, to be a leader in healthcare design.
